Summary

United States Average Layers Down 2 Percent: Layers during 2020 averaged 
390 million, down 2 percent from the year earlier. The annual average 
production per layer on hand in 2020 was 286 eggs, up 1 percent from 2019.

United States Egg Production Down 1 Percent: Egg production during the year 
ending November 30, 2020 totaled 112 billion eggs, down 1 percent from 2019. 
Table egg production, at 96.9 billion eggs, was down 2 percent from the 
previous year. Hatching egg production, at 14.7 billion eggs, was up 
4 percent from 2019.

United States December 1 Chicken Inventory: The total inventory of chickens 
on hand on December 1, 2020 (excluding commercial broilers) was 518 million 
birds, down 3 percent from last year.

United States Total Value: The total value of all chickens on December 1, 
2020 was $2.58 billion, up 9 percent from December 1, 2019. The average value 
increased from $4.43 per bird on December 1, 2019, to $4.97 per bird on 
December 1, 2020.

Statistical Methodology

Survey Procedures: Primary data for the Chickens and Eggs report are from 
monthly questionnaires sent to producers. An attempt is made to collect 
information for layer and egg estimates from each known contractor and 
independent producer who has at least 30,000 table egg layers, flocks of 
hatchery supply layers, or pullet only operations with at least 500 pullets. 
Coverage for operations with less than 30,000 table egg layers are estimated 
each month based on Agricultural Census data and data reported in December. 
Approximately 500 contractors, independent egg producers, and pullet only 
operations are contacted each month. 

Estimating Procedures: Sound statistical methodology is employed to derive 
estimates from the reported data. All data are analyzed for unusual values. 
Data from each operation are compared to their own past operating profile and 
to trends from similar operations. Data for missing operations are estimated 
based on similar operations or historical data. NASS field offices prepare 
these estimates by using a combination of survey indications and historic 
trends. Individual State estimates are reviewed by the Agricultural 
Statistics Board for reasonableness. 

Revision Policy: The previous 24 month's estimates are subject to revision if 
late reports or corrected data indicates a different level. Estimates will 
also be reviewed after data from the Department of Agriculture five-year 
Census of Agriculture are available. No revisions will be made after that 
date.
 
Reliability: Estimates are based on a census of all known contractors and 
independent producers who have at least 30,000 table egg layers, flocks of 
hatchery supply layers, and pullet only operations with at least 500 pullets 
and therefore, have no sampling error. However, estimates are subject to 
errors such as omission, duplication, and mistakes in reporting, recording, 
and processing the data. While these errors cannot be measured directly, they 
are minimized through strict quality controls in the data collection process 
and a careful review of all reported data for consistency and reasonableness.

Terms and Definitions of Chickens and Eggs Estimates

All Layers includes both table egg and hatching egg flocks regardless of 
size.

Molted Layers is the same data series as the previously published Forced Molt 
Layers. Nomenclature changed as of January 2015.
